Weekly Roundup: May 29th, 2020

May 29, 2020
The podcast dives into President Trump's response to nationwide protests and highlights Biden's call for empathy towards the pain of Black Americans. It also discusses the staggering milestone of 100,000 COVID-19 deaths in the U.S. Listeners are treated to personal anecdotes about parenting and nostalgic moments amidst the pandemic. Additionally, the impact of COVID-19 on various demographics and political dynamics is explored, alongside a light-hearted chat about raising unusual pets like chickens during quarantine.

Trump's Controversial Tweet

  • President Trump's tweet about Minneapolis protests sparked controversy.
  • Twitter hid the tweet for glorifying violence.
INSIGHT

Historical Context of "Looting leads to Shooting"

  • "Looting leads to shooting" has historical ties to racist policing.
  • It references policies that protesters oppose.
INSIGHT

Biden's Remarks on George Floyd

  • Joe Biden discussed George Floyd's death.
  • He framed it within a broader context of systemic racism.
